If you are looking for a destination near N.E. Ohio, you should try our neighbors to the east in Volant Pennsylvania. Volant is a small town that's easy to reach just east of the Ohio border near Youngstown Ohio. If you look on a PA map, Volant is just east of New Castle PA a few miles on PA Rt 168. To get there, you could take Rt 80 east and hook up with Rt 19 going south, or if you want the scenic routes you could take RT 62 east into PA and catch RT 19 and go south to Volant. It's not a long trip, and once you get there you will find many nice little shops, a grist mill, restaurants and a great little fishing tackle shop. You can park the bike and walk up and down main street to most of the shops without moving your bike. Just north of Volant on PA RT 19 is a great restaurant called the Iron Bridge Inn which I recommend highly. I got the best swordfish there that I have ever eaten. You do have to be careful while riding the back roads of PA, they have a somewhat large bear population, just be careful not to hit one.
